Job Description

Driven by our team of over 300 people from more than 40 different countries, Omio is changing the way we travel across Europe. With Omio you can compare and book trains, buses and flights to anywhere in Europe with one simple search, on mobile, app or desktop. By offering transparent pricing and easy booking, Omio makes travel planning simple, flexible and personal.

Tasks

Leading a team of data scientists and analysts working closely with stakeholders to define product roadmap, implement and analysis new features and improve retention

Collaborate closely with different teams, most predominantly in technology areas such as Product, Engineering, and Design, or the Management teams to develop a customer-driven and data-driven strategy to drive product evolution, enhance customer experience and deliver growth and financial impact.

Apply statistical methods to analyze and mine business data, identify correlations and new metrics, find trends and patterns, and create data reports to formulate, answer questions and solve business problems.

Your main responsibilities:

  • Lead the Product Analytics team, set priorities, roadmap and pipeline and development impulses
  • Disciplinary leadership for people in the Product Analytics team, driving learning and development opportunities
  • Perform statistical analyses - including A/B tests and pre/post analyses on feature usage to advise on feature adoption and evolution
  • Foster and initiate machine-learning and model based analyses to support product initiatives
  • Lead weekly Product Performance Review, deep-dive on top-line metrics and funnel KPIs to advise business
  • Support product & tech organization in ad-hoc analyses, guide and steer usage of KPIs in these departments
  • Develop core intuition on business performance. Thus becoming the go-to person on product (comprising engineering and design contributions) performance and KPIs
  • Drive consistency and best-practice for front-end tracking approaches, team-up with respective teams for implementation
  • Generate tactical insights from analytics and visualisation to shape the product strategy
  • Act as an advocate of our company s data-driven culture: produce reports that are actionable, dashboards that are diagnostic, and recommendations that drive growth

Requirements

What we are looking for:

  • University degree in Business, Engineering, Economics, Statistics, Mathematics, or a similar field; 7+ years of relevant work experience, preferably in e-commerce
  • Passionate about working with numbers; you hold excellent analytical skills, have confidence in working with large data sets and are an expert in SQL and Excel/Google sheets (R/Python is a plus)
  • Proven track record in running conclusive experiments; ideally in both App and Web environments
  • A good understanding of machine learning and AI models and how to utilize them for business growth and better customer experience
  • You are fluent in English; additional languages are always valued at Omio
  • You are a team player with excellent communication and stakeholder management skills
  • You take a solution oriented approach to problem solving
  • You have led a small team with success and enjoy empowering others to grow in their career path
